#VU65256 Out-of-bounds read in Character Animator


Published: 2022-07-13 | Updated: 2022-07-14

Vulnerability identifier: #VU65256

Vulnerability risk: High

CVSSv3.1: 7.7 [C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H/E:U/RL:O/RC:C]

CVE-ID: CVE-2022-34242

CWE-ID: CWE-125

Exploitation vector: Network

Exploit availability: No

Vulnerable software:
Character Animator
Client/Desktop applications / Office applications

Vendor: Adobe

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to compromise the affected system.

The vulnerability exists due to a boundary condition when parsing SVG files. A remote attacker can create a specially crafted SVG file, trick the victim into opening it, trigger an out-of-bounds read error and execute arbitrary code on the system.

Mitigation
Install updates from vendor's website.

Vulnerable software versions

Character Animator: 22.0 - 22.4, 4.0 - 4.4.7
